Transaction 78880900d21d05d22fd006729c5241f77069024a0fe0052507aaf285bc401840
1 Input
1 Output
-
78880900d21d05d22fd006729c5241f77069024a0fe0052507aaf285bc401840: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c20c7ed79f3a7f00a352d4d6984512b7d6637da3743a6fea031ed34a422637b6
- address
- bc1pcgx8a4ul8flspg6j6ntfs3gjkltxxldrwsaxl6srrmf55s3xx7mqldteln